RAFE / Fusion trajectory intelligence
RAFE connects operating context with relationships across fusion diagnostics. It maps how the plasma state is evolving, compares recovery paths and presents intervention-window estimates in a clear operator view.
Trajectory intelligence
The plasma state is expressed through timing, coupling, divergence and drift across diagnostics. RAFE combines these relationships into a developing system view.
It compares plausible trajectories, estimates how recovery options evolve and presents the evidence supporting each assessment, giving researchers and operators a clearer view of where the state is heading and which options remain.

The analytical workflow
RAFE brings context, relationships, trajectories, supporting evidence and stated confidence into one analytical workflow.
Bring diagnostic records together with timing, data quality and operating conditions.
Track coupling, divergence and drift across signals as the plasma state evolves.
Assess plausible trajectories, recoverability and the timing of available options.
Present the assessment, supporting signals and confidence levels through a clear operator-centred analytical view.
Facility integration
RAFE presents traceable analytical outputs alongside established diagnostic, engineering and protection workflows. Data interfaces, analytical thresholds, review points and presentation layers can be configured to each facility.
